Help Mr. Robot get fixed! Give your students this fun worksheet where they need to guide him through the maze to the Repair Station. The paths they need to take are the ones with shapes that have 1/3 colored. Encourage them to look carefully and trace Mr. Robot through those paths.

How to train the Develops planning skill in Grade 3 students learning about Geometry?

To train Grade 3 students' planning skills in Geometry, integrate hands-on activities like building shapes with physical materials (e.g., toothpicks, clay). Use puzzles and games that require geometric reasoning. Incorporate project-based learning, where they plan and execute models or drawings of geometric concepts. Encourage them to predict and plan their steps before starting, fostering critical thinking and strategic planning.

Why is the Develops planning skill important for Grade 3 students?

Developing planning skills in Grade 3 students is crucial as it aids in fostering independence, improving organizational abilities, and enhancing academic performance. At this stage, children become more capable of managing their tasks and responsibilities, making it an ideal time to cultivate these skills.
